How they compare

Dominican Republic currently reports 8.77 billion current US$ against 8.12 billion current US$ in Côte d'Ivoire, a difference of 647.60 million current US$.

That makes Dominican Republic's figure about 1.1 times Côte d'Ivoire's.

Across all 11 years both countries report, Dominican Republic has been ahead every year.

Côte d'Ivoire ranks 66th and Dominican Republic ranks 65th of 199 countries.

Dominican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Taxes less subsidies on products are taxes payable per unit of a good or service.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This indicator is expressed in United States dollars.
